Let me start with my Ram - it's 2006 4x2 stock 20" wheels, stock height.
I originally wanted to lift the truck a bit to at least achieve 4x4 look. But decided not to due to funds. So right now I need new tires, and I was hoping maybe tires would let me bring the truck up a bit.
Factory tires are 275/60/R20, I thought of maybe going with slightly taller tire (maybe 275/70/20 or 285/70/20) and wanted to see if that has been done on 4x2 and how it looks. Will it even work. If not, then what would you guys recommend, go with taller tire or not? If so, then would Goodrich A/T be good?

not many sizes that are "taller" withou going wider really, so that will limit you right there. Given you got a 2wd beast, Cooper sound very reasonable for you. They are gonna look beefier than those stock HO's anyday so i think you'[ll find taller not necessarily to be better. Also taller with the 275 width will look kinda narrow as they are already breeching upon.
If you go taller, your gonna need to go wider to compliment the looks and a taller tire on a 2wd won't look that good IMO.
Maybe a wider tire for a 4x4 look more than a taller tire. 305/50/20? A bit wider and a lil bit smaller in height. Near same price as 275/60/20 LTZ's are $170 shipped from Treaddepot
